#251b0c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#251b0c is composed of 14.5% red, 10.6%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 27% magenta, 67.6% yellow and 85.5% black. It has a hue angle of 36 degrees, a saturation of 51% and a lightness of 9.6%. #251b0c color hex could be obtained by blending #4a3618 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

Shades and Tints of #251b0c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070502 is the darkest color, while #fdfbf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#251b0c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1a1917 is the less saturated color, while #301d01 is the most saturated one.
